| US EPA Environmental Data Registry Code Sets |
Code
Sets contain permissible values, value meaning names, and value meaning
definitions that can be used in application development. Some of these
Code Sets are related to EPA data standards.

| Data Source Codes for the 2002 National Emission Inventory, Nov 27, 2006, Version 2 |
Data Source Codes Spreadsheet (XLS 30K) this file contains the data source codes for all sectors of the 2002 NEI. These codes indicate where the data came from.

| Standard Industrial Classification (SIC) |
Below are some useful links that provide SIC information.
| NOTE: The Standard Industrial Classification (SIC) coding
system has been superseded by the NAICS
coding system. The links below are available for historical purposes
only. |
